Merge SP-API JSON Order Arrays

Demonstrates how to merge JSON arrays for the case of Amazon SP-API orders.

program ChilkatDemo;

// Demonstrates using the Chilkat Pascal wrapper via the C bridge DLL.
// Builds as a console application under Lazarus (FPC) or Delphi.

{$IFDEF FPC}
  {$MODE DELPHI}
{$ENDIF}
{$APPTYPE CONSOLE}

uses
  {$IFDEF UNIX}
  cthreads,
  {$ENDIF}
  SysUtils,
  CkDllLoader,
  Chilkat.JsonArray,
  Chilkat.JsonObject;

// ---------------------------------------------------------------------------

procedure RunDemo;
var
  success: Boolean;
  a1: string;
  a2: string;
  json1: TJsonObject;
  json2: TJsonObject;
  jarr1: TJsonArray;
  jarr2: TJsonArray;
  i: Integer;
  numOrders: Integer;
  jOrder: TJsonObject;

begin
  success := False;

  //  Batch 1 File
  a1 := '{"payload": {"Orders": [{"AmazonOrderId": "1","OrderStatus": "Unshipped"},{"AmazonOrderId": "2","OrderStatus": "Unshipped"}]}';

  //  Batch 2 File
  a2 := '{"payload": {"Orders": [{"AmazonOrderId": "3","OrderStatus": "Unshipped"},{"AmazonOrderId": "4","OrderStatus": "Unshipped"}]}';

  //  Required Merged File
  //  {"payload": {"Orders": [{"AmazonOrderId": "1","OrderStatus": "Unshipped"},{"AmazonOrderId": "2","OrderStatus": "Unshipped"},{"AmazonOrderId": "3","OrderStatus": "Unshipped"},{"AmazonOrderId": "4","OrderStatus": "Unshipped"}]}

  success := True;
  json1 := TJsonObject.Create;
  json1.Load(a1);

  json2 := TJsonObject.Create;
  json2.Load(a2);

  //  We're going to add the order records from json2 to json1.
  jarr1 := json1.ArrayOf('payload.Orders');
  jarr2 := json2.ArrayOf('payload.Orders');

  i := 0;
  numOrders := jarr2.Size;
  while (i < numOrders) do
    begin
      jOrder := jarr2.ObjectAt(i);
      //  Assuming non-null return...
      jarr1.AddObjectCopyAt(-1,jOrder);
      i := i + 1;
    end;

  //  Show the merged JSON.
  json1.EmitCompact := False;
  WriteLn(json1.Emit());

  //  Result:

  //  {
  //    "payload": {
  //      "Orders": [
  //        {
  //          "AmazonOrderId": "1",
  //          "OrderStatus": "Unshipped"
  //        },
  //        {
  //          "AmazonOrderId": "2",
  //          "OrderStatus": "Unshipped"
  //        },
  //        {
  //          "AmazonOrderId": "3",
  //          "OrderStatus": "Unshipped"
  //        },
  //        {
  //          "AmazonOrderId": "4",
  //          "OrderStatus": "Unshipped"
  //        }
  //      ]
  //    }
  //  }


  json1.Free;
  json2.Free;

end;

// ---------------------------------------------------------------------------

begin

  try
    RunDemo;
  except
    on E: Exception do
      WriteLn('Unhandled exception: ', E.ClassName, ': ', E.Message);
  end;

  WriteLn;
  {$IFDEF MSWINDOWS}
  WriteLn('Press Enter to exit...');
  ReadLn;
  {$ENDIF}
end.
